The Orepuki Advocate _ learns that M'Gregor and party are erecting an elevating plant on the beach beyond the Waiau. Several attempts have been made to work the auriferous deposits known to exist in that district, with varying success. The party has a strong water supply, a-nd with ai> up-to-date plant, should soon prove be yond a doubt the payable nature of beaoh wash.
